UEIC showed significant operational improvements with operating losses narrowing 58% and operating cash flow surging 59%, while reducing share count through buybacks despite maintaining loss-making status.
The company appears to be executing a successful turnaround strategy, dramatically improving cash generation and operational efficiency while reducing debt burdens. However, investors should note the continued losses and significant asset base contraction, suggesting ongoing operational challenges despite the positive momentum.
UEIC demonstrated strong operational improvements with operating cash flow jumping 59% to $23.6M and operating losses narrowing by 58%, while the company reduced total liabilities by 25% and increased cash reserves by 21%. The 15% decline in total assets and 23% reduction in accounts receivable suggests improved working capital management and potentially lower sales volumes. Overall, the financials signal a company in transition with improving operational efficiency and stronger cash position, though still generating losses and managing through a period of asset optimization.
